Sr Manager, Software Development - Commissions

Job Description:

Sr Manager, Software Development - Commissions

The Sr. Manager of Development for Frontline Commissions systems is responsible for several teams providing development, maintenance, support, and enhancement services for T-Mobile Commissions applications/systems that support critical business functions and may either be custom developed or a packaged solution requiring a combination of development and configuration.

Requires competency in customer focus, change & innovation, strategic thinking, relationship building & influencing, talent management, results focus and inspirational leadership.


Responsibilities:

  • BUILD STAFFING PLANS that ensure management and development teams are staffed with skill sets required to enhance existing systems as well as deliver new systems functionality required by the business.
  • INTERVIEW AND HIRE qualified managers and developers, striving to improve T-Mobile bench strength and augmenting project teams with contract staff when required.
  • WORKFLOW MANAGEMENT - Work with other management to understand project and business priorities and schedule work with development staff based on those priorities.
  • PERFORMANCE MANAGEMENT - Effectively lead teams providing appropriate direction and developmental feedback, conducting annual reviews and participating in compensation decisions.
  • RECOMMEND NEW TECHNOLOGY DIRECTIONS in collaboration with Design and Enterprise Architecture teams
  • TRAINING AND CAREER DEVELOPMENT- Work with managers and developers to build training and career development plans and work to ensure assignments with increasing levels of responsibility are given to management and development staff.
  • BUDGET - Provide input for departmental budgets and work to manage operational and capital expenses in order to meet budget.
  • RESOURCE ALLOCATION - Plan for and ensure that management and development staff have tools/skills required to perform job functions (workstations, software, servers, disk space, training, etc.).
  • Constantly improve the DEVELOPMENT PROCESSES, tools and methodologies used in the development group
  • Responsible for DELIVERY OF HIGH QUALITY products on time and within budget.
  • Provide TECHNICAL GUIDANCE to the team as necessary.
  • Work with Business Partners and other cross functional teams and build and present technical solutions and road maps that align with business objectives and goals.


Qualifications:

  • Minimum 7 years experience developing large scale business systems applications.
  • Minimum 8 years of management experience with programming staff including leadership, planning, and coordination of development work for 4 large projects.
  • Minimum overall IT experience, 10 years.
  • Experience in designing, developing or configuring enterprise applications in the Commissions Management domain, sales performance management or incentive compensation management.
  • Experience in Implementing, integrating, developing on, extending and operating Sales Performance Management (SPM) and Incentive Compensation Management (ICM) packages such as IBM ââ,¬ Incentive Compensation Management (Varicent), Callidus, Merced, Oracle, Synygy, Centive, etc.
  • SOLID UNDERSTANDING of software development principles.
  • Experience in HIGH VOLUME (transactions) and high-availability systems
  • Experience in architecting, designing building, testing and implementing large-scale, high volume transactional systems in the Retail, Web, Finance domains
  • Experienced in software development life-cycles, including Agile and Scrum-based models and running dev-ops teams.
  • Experienced in Leading complex software development efforts particularly those requiring strong vendor management, business relationship and consulting skills
  • Understanding of multiple operating systems, databases and development frameworks and technologies, including prior hands-on experience in the following development languages and frameworks: J2EE, Java, C#, .net, PL/SQL, XML, XSL, HTML, DHTML and Visual Basic.
  • Understanding of SOA, Architecture Frameworks, Estimation
  • Knowledge of data warehousing components (data acquisition, ETL, data modeling, infrastructure, profiling and reporting)
  • SKILLS AND KNOWLEDGE acquired through Management Experience are required in each of the following areas: AGILE Systems Development Life Cycle Methodologies ââ,¬ including Development, Testing, Requirements Gathering, and Systems Analysis and Design, Project Management, Release Management and Configuration Management
  • Demonstrated ability to mentor technical management and technical professionals.
  • Ability to organize several teams and focus on best practices, particularly regarding coding standards and quality assurance.
  • Strong working knowledge of development life cycle management.

Education
Minimum Required
B.S. Computer Science or Management Information Systems

Company Profile:

As Americaââ,¬â„¢s Un-carrier, T-Mobile US, Inc. (NASDAQ: ââ,¬Å"TMUSââ,¬?) is redefining the way consumers and businesses buy wireless services through leading product and service innovation. The companyââ,¬â„¢s advanced nationwide 4G and 4G LTE network delivers outstanding wireless experiences for customers who are unwilling to compromise on quality and value. Based in Bellevue, Washington, T-Mobile US provides services through its subsidiaries and operates its flagship brands, T-Mobile and MetroPCS. For more information, please visit http://www.t-mobile.com

EOE Statement:

We Take Equal Opportunity Seriously - By Choice

T-Mobile USA, Inc. is an Equal Opportunity Employer. All decisions concerning the employment relationship will be made without regard to age, race, ethnicity, color, religion, creed, sex, sexual orientation, gender identity or expression, national origin, marital status, citizenship status, veteran status, the presence of any physical or mental disability, or any other status or characteristic protected by federal, state, or local law. Discrimination or harassment based upon any of these factors is wholly inconsistent with our Company values and will not be tolerated. Furthermore, such discrimination or harassment may violate federal, state, or local law.


Meet Some of T-Mobile's Employees

Diego L.

Retail Associate Manager

Diego assists the store manager with day-to-day operations while working to develop the roles of his associates through hands-on sales coaching.

Indy C.

Retail Associate Manager

Indy aims to ensure complete customer satisfaction by assisting sales associates with tricky transactions and creating a fun, friendly, and energetic vibe in her store.


Back to top